Continuity Of Attachment
Refers to the concept that emotional and social attachments formed in childhood persist over time, influencing an individual's relationships and emotional well-being throughout their life.
Early Adolescence
A developmental stage that typically occurs between the ages of 10 and 14, characterized by rapid physical growth, cognitive development, and emotional changes.
Early Adulthood
A life stage following adolescence, typically defined as the period from ages 20 to 40, characterized by reaching full physical maturity, and assuming adult roles.
Intelligence Test Scores
Quantitative measures used to assess an individual's intellectual abilities compared to the general population.
